OP - if they type in broken English in An industry where you can't buy much internationally, like firearms and related stuff, it is almost certainly a scam. If they only take money transfers and no CC, it is a scam. If they have a ton of powder or components that no one else has, or if it doesn't go out of stock in like 5 minutes, it is almost certainly a scam. If they show a map on the Contact Us page and it shows a picture with a different map location than what is stated on their website, it is likely a scam.
